What is a ticketing system? Everything you need to know in 2025
Every unanswered customer query is a lost opportunity, yet many businesses still struggle with scattered support requests across multiple channels. Modern ticketing solutions turn this chaos into streamlined operations through AI-powered automation and omnichannel support. Freshdesk delivers on this promise with industry-leading AI capabilities and intelligent automation workflows. Start your upgrade today!
Sep 03, 2025
Retaining customers has never been more challenging. In today’s hyper-competitive market, one bad support experience is all it takes to lose a customer forever. With patience levels at an all-time low, quick, accurate, and personalized support is no longer just good to have, but essential. It has become a deciding factor in whether a customer stays or churns.
According to G2, 7 out of 10 customers have stopped doing business with a brand after a poor experience. On the flip side, a positive experience makes them 3.5x more likely to repurchase and far more likely to recommend your brand. In short, great customer service doesn’t just retain customers, it multiplies growth.
But here’s the challenge: businesses handling high ticket volumes often struggle to keep up with these rising expectations. The result? Frustrated customers, missed SLAs, and preventable churn.
An advanced ticketing system can be the ultimate game-changer for businesses facing these challenges. By centralizing requests, ensuring every ticket is addressed on time, and leveraging AI for accuracy and personalization, these systems enable support teams to deliver at scale.
Curious how these systems work and what makes them indispensable? This guide will help you understand what a ticketing system is, its features, benefits, and the top solutions available in the market that you can choose.
What is a ticketing system?
A ticketing system is a centralized platform designed to capture, organize, and manage all customer support requests from multiple platforms in one place. This system automatically converts all the reported customer complaints or queries into easily manageable and trackable tickets.
Each ticket contains essential details about the customer and their issue, giving support agents full context to respond accurately and empathetically. This ensures no request is overlooked, and customers feel heard and valued.
If you are a growing business, you’ve likely felt the chaos of handling a flood of tickets from multiple channels. Complaints and queries pour in from every direction: email, phone, live chat, and even social media comments, which often get lost in the sea of tickets. Without the right system or adequate staffing, important customers risk getting frustrated, churning, and switching to competitors offering better support. This is where a ticketing system steps in.
The example below will help simplify the concept of a ticketing system for you.
An online clothing store receives hundreds of emails daily for order tracking, refunds, and exchanges. Without a ticketing system, queries are missed or answered twice, leaving customers frustrated. With a ticketing system, each query becomes a trackable ticket, auto-assigned to the right agent, ensuring faster responses, better collaboration, and happier customers. |
How does a ticketing system work?
Now that you know what a ticketing system is, it’s time to see how it works. Here’s a step-by-step breakdown of the process.
1. Capturing customer queries
The system captures customer inquiries from multiple channels such as email, social media, chat, phone, messaging apps, etc., and stores them in a central location, often in a shared inbox. Capturing these queries in one place makes them easy to organize and manage, ensuring no request is missed or answered twice, and every customer receives the right attention.
2. Converting queries into tickets
The collected queries are then converted into tickets, each with a unique ID for easy tracking and management. Every ticket contains a complete issue description, interaction history, customer contact information, and timestamps. This gives agents full context, enabling quicker and more accurate resolutions.
3. Categorizing and prioritizing tickets
The system analyzes each ticket and assigns categories and priorities for quicker escalations. Categories may include service type (billing, sales, technical), issue complexity (basic, moderate, complex), or department type (legal, billing, QA, product, technical, support, etc.). The system also assigns priorities in terms of urgency, impact (widespread, individual, or limited), SLA deadlines, and customer tier (premium, freemium, or standard).
4. Assigning tickets to agents or teams
Once categorized, tickets are routed to the right agent and concerned department for resolution. Traditionally, this routing was manual, but modern ticketing systems use AI and workflow rules like skills-based or load-based assignment to automate the process.
5. Collaborating for resolution
Some tickets require input from multiple departments. For example, a billing issue might first be handled by support, then escalated to finance, and if the root cause is a software bug, passed to the technical team.
Ticketing systems provide collaboration tools such as internal notes, @mentions, shared ownership, and parent-child ticketing to ensure seamless communication across teams. This prevents customers from having to repeat their problems multiple times.
6. Tracking progress and status updates
Once assigned, tickets are tracked until they are resolved or closed. Each ticket is assigned a status, i.e., open, on-hold, resolved, closed, or awaiting customer reply. To keep teams aligned, ticketing systems feature dashboards that highlight the assigned agent, ticket details, and real-time status, preventing overlap in handling.
7. Closing the ticket and notifying customers
When an issue is resolved, the agent formally closes the ticket. Customers are notified of the closure, ensuring they are aware of the resolution. This also acts as a record of the solution for both the agent and the customer. Additionally, once a ticket is closed, customers instantly receive a post-interaction feedback survey to rate their support experience.
8. Analyzing performance
A ticketing system also enables CX leaders to analyze team and agent performance, as well as customer satisfaction through strong reporting and analytics. It tracks key KPIs such as response time, average handle time, and CSAT to measure how fast and effectively agents resolve tickets. These insights help identify areas for improvement and provide targeted training to boost agent productivity.
Key features and capabilities of a ticketing system
A good ticketing system doesn’t just track issues and assign agents to resolve them; it does much more. It ensures each ticket is addressed within a set timeframe, enhances agent productivity, provides valuable insights into service operations, and boosts customer satisfaction. Here are the core capabilities of a ticketing system that make this happen:
1. Omnichannel support
Omnichannel support enables businesses to capture requests from multiple channels (email, call, SMS, and social media) into a centralized location by converting them into tickets, ensuring none are lost or duplicated. It also eliminates the need for agents to switch between platforms to respond to customers across channels.
2. Unified agent workspace
A centralized agent workspace allows agents to manage tickets from all channels in one place, with full context. Regardless of the channel, agents can view the entire ticket history and customer details, and provide accurate, context-rich resolutions.
3. Automation and workflow management
Automated ticketing systems eliminate repetitive tasks such as ticket categorization, prioritization, and assignment. This frees up agents to focus on higher-priority tasks that require urgent attention. Beyond ticket triaging, it can also handle tasks like status updates, customer notifications about ticket progress, and the use of macros (pre-written responses for common queries). These automations are typically powered by a combination of AI and rules-based workflows.
4. AI agent (virtual agent/chatbot)
Modern ticketing systems include AI agents (AI-powered bots) that interact with customers directly, resolve common queries using the knowledge base, and suggest relevant articles for better understanding. For complex issues, they gather customer details and escalate cases to human agents, providing them with the necessary context.
Freshdesk’s Freddy AI, for example, understands customer intent, delivers personalized responses, and automates routine support tasks. It has helped multiple businesses reduce response times by 83% and resolve conversations in under 2 minutes.
5. AI Copilot for human agents
AI Copilot augments the capabilities of human agents by helping them deliver faster, accurate, and more satisfactory resolutions. They summarize lengthy customer interactions, analyze sentiment, and suggest empathetic responses. They also streamline knowledge retrieval, allowing agents to instantly access and attach relevant articles from the knowledge base to support their responses.
Freshdesk’s Freddy AI Copilot is a prime example of an advanced AI support Copilot. With thread summarization, it helps reduce response drafting time by 56%, while its writing assistance and sentiment analysis enable more contextual, empathetic responses, improving response quality by 67%.
6. Internal collaboration tools
A customer support collaboration tool enables agents from the same or cross-functional teams to collaborate on a single ticket and deliver faster resolutions without cluttering customer-facing communication.
Using private notes and @mentions, agents can tag colleagues for additional input. With ticket escalation features, agents can fully transfer the ticket to a supervisor or senior person for handling complex or highly sensitive matters.
7. Out-of-the-box interface
Ticketing systems are often available as pre-configured, ready-to-use software that is easy to install and launch with minimal setup, requiring no heavy custom development. They feature a user-friendly interface that needs little to no training, enabling teams to get started and onboard faster.
8. Self-service portals and knowledge base integration
These systems enable you to build and integrate a knowledge base of articles, guides, and FAQs with your brand. This knowledge base powers self-service portals, often supported by AI agents, where customers can find answers to common queries on their own.
With AI assistance, support agents can also convert conversation threads into knowledge base articles, ensuring the portal grows continuously with useful content. As a result, more tickets are deflected, reducing overall ticket volumes and easing the load on support teams.
9. Reporting and analytics
Support teams can access pre-built customer service reports and analytics on metrics like ticket volumes and resolution times, as well as custom reports for factors such as agent availability, average handle time, and first-contact resolution rates. Using these reports, businesses can easily identify inefficiencies in their operations and improve support.
10. SLA tracking
The system allows managers to define SLAs (service level agreements) that set standards for response times and agent availability. Once established, it monitors these SLAs to ensure deadlines are met and customer inquiries are resolved on time.
If a breach occurs, the relevant agent and supervisor are notified to address the issue promptly, fostering accountability and customer trust.
11. Customer feedback and CSAT tracking
This system enables businesses to track customer satisfaction metrics by sending surveys after each interaction. These post-resolution surveys include CSAT (Customer Satisfaction Score) surveys, which measure how satisfied customers are with the resolution.
They also include NPS (Net Promoter Score) surveys, which measure how likely customers are to recommend your business. Together, these reflect both customer loyalty and satisfaction with your support.
12. Integrations with third-party business apps
Almost all leading ticketing systems allow integration with third-party business software such as CRM tools, billing software, project management tools, and more, creating a connected ecosystem. This gives support teams the context they need to understand customers and provide accurate responses without switching between different tools to gather information.
Benefits of using a ticketing solution
Using a ticketing solution benefits not only a business but also its customers and support agents. Let’s explore its advantages for each stakeholder.
Benefits for customers
1. Faster resolution
Self-service portals integrated with knowledge bases and AI agents empower customers to resolve queries on their own without relying on human representatives. By eliminating long back-and-forth conversations for common issues, this approach delivers quicker resolutions and a more seamless support experience.
2. Better transparency
Customers can track the status of their requests in real-time using unique ticket IDs and self-service portals. This visibility reduces frustration and reassures customers that their issues are being actively addressed.
3. 24/7 help availability via AI
AI agents and chatbots allow customers to resolve common inquiries independently, even outside business hours. These agents can also provide relevant help articles from the knowledge base, offering better context.
4. More convenience and flexibility
Customers can submit queries and complaints through multiple channels of their choice, such as email, chat, phone, or social media like Instagram DMs. This way, they don’t have to rely on a single channel for support.
5. Consistent, reliable experience
A ticketing system ensures that customers receive a consistent experience across all channels, without needing to repeat their issues when redirected to different agents. With a complete context and unified view, agents can provide context-aware responses, ensuring common issues are resolved promptly.
Benefits for support agents
1. Centralized workspace
Agents get a unified workspace where all customer queries from multiple channels are consolidated, along with complete customer profiles and relevant information about the issue. This eliminates the need to switch between multiple inboxes and platforms, enabling faster query resolution.
2. Better collaboration
Ticketing systems provide collaboration tools like private notes, shared ownership, and @mentions. These collaboration tools allow agents to work seamlessly with colleagues and cross-functional teams to resolve complex issues faster.
3. Reduced workload
AI Copilot, AI agents, and automated workflows eliminate repetitive queries, speed up workflows, and reduce time spent on redundant tasks. With more tickets getting handled without agent intervention, support teams can save significant time and focus only on priority issues or complex queries that require immediate attention.
4. Access to a knowledge base
Agents can quickly provide contextual and accurate responses using knowledge base articles. This equips them with complete information and helpful resources to resolve customer queries effectively, resulting in a significantly improved overall customer experience.
5. Enhanced productivity
With AI Copilots, agents can retrieve the right context from the knowledge base, summarize lengthy interaction threads, and get writing assistance for empathetic and well-toned responses. This reduces time spent understanding problems and speeds up responses, enabling agents to handle more queries and boost overall productivity.
Benefits for businesses
1. Better operational efficiency
With most redundant tasks automated, such as ticket routing, prioritization, and resolution of L0 queries by AI agents, human representatives are freed up to focus on important and complex issues. This ensures that routine queries and repetitive tasks are handled automatically while critical matters receive human attention. As a result, all types of queries can be resolved on time, boosting overall operational efficiency.
2. Improved customer retention
Retaining customers is more cost-effective than acquiring new ones. A ticketing system enables support teams to deliver quicker and more helpful responses, making customers feel valued and reinforcing your brand’s reliability. This ultimately boosts customer satisfaction and leads to better retention rates.
3. Data-driven insights
With both pre-built and custom reports, businesses can track important KPIs such as response times, average handle time, ticket volume, customer satisfaction scores, and more. This helps monitor overall team performance, individual agent performance, and customer experience. These insights enable businesses to refine their strategies, identify training needs for agents, and boost overall productivity.
4. Better scalability
A ticketing system enables businesses to handle more queries with their existing staff, allowing them to scale effortlessly without overburdening employees as ticket volume increases. More importantly, it helps manage tickets better during peak hours, seasonal sales, and festival periods without needing to hire extra staff.
5. Cost-efficiency over fragmented tools
While investing in ticketing software may require an initial investment, it is cost-effective in the long run. A centralized system eliminates the need to juggle multiple platforms and prevents tickets from getting lost. This saves time and ensures efficient query resolution. As a result, customers are more satisfied and more likely to continue doing business with the company.
5 leading ticketing software solutions of 2025
With the widespread adoption of ticketing software solutions, businesses have a vast number of options to choose from, each with its own pros and cons, which can often overwhelm users. To simplify the decision, we have selected the top five most popular ticketing solutions, based on their user base, affordability, and advanced automation features.
Product | Base Price | Key Features |
---|---|---|
Freshdesk | $15/agent/month | Freddy AI agent Freddy AI Copilot AI-driven workflows Omnichannel support Unified agent workspace Advanced self-service portal Reporting and analytics Out-of-the-box interface 1,200+ integrations |
HubSpot Service Hub | $90/month/seat | Omnichannel support Team management Breeze AI agent Fully integrated smart CRM |
Zendesk | $19/agent/month | Multichannel support Knowledge base software AI-driven automation Workforce management |
Zoho Desk | $7/agent/month | Omnichannel support Zia AI engine Self-service portal Third-party integrations |
Salesforce Service Cloud | $25/user/month | Agentforce for Service (AI engine) Omnichannel ticket management Incident management Unified agent workspace |
Success stories: real businesses using ticketing software effectively
So far, we have learned what a ticketing solution is, how it works, essential features, and best options. Now, let’s take a look at a few real-world examples of businesses excelling in customer support with a ticketing system. Here are a few success stories of Freshdesk’s users achieving skyrocketing CSAT and customer experience with ticketing automation:
1. Hinge Health
Hinge Health, a leading digital health startup, offers a virtual clinic for back and joint pain, connecting patients with healthcare providers. Before integrating Freshdesk, the team struggled to manage growing ticket volumes due to the lack of a centralized platform and poor internal workflows, which led to missed queries. They also faced difficulties in tracking SLAs.
Freshdesk’s HIPAA-compliant ticketing solution provided secure handling of member information along with true omnichannel support. It reduced response times from hours to minutes through AI chatbots, ensuring members received seamless support across channels. With in-product chat, the team could also deliver quick assistance through wearables, greatly improving customer satisfaction and service experience.
Impact in numbers
92% SLA compliance | 85% CSAT | +3,685% Ticket volume scale over four years |
User review
“Freshdesk has helped us install more efficient workflows and processes while still maintaining HIPAA compliance. It has been a game-changer for agents and members." Mahmoud Shehadeh Director of Member Support, Hinge Health |
2. Bridgestone
Bridgestone, the world’s leading tire production and distribution company, adopted Freshdesk to overcome challenges with its outdated ticketing system. The lack of multichannel support and limited resources had left customers unsatisfied.
With Freshdesk, they were able to provide superior multichannel support and respond to every customer on time. Service Level Agreements (SLAs) enhanced the team's productivity, enabling them to scale customer support by 95%. Additionally, satisfaction surveys helped measure customer happiness.
Impact in numbers
150 Days on Freshdesk | 4,000+ Tickets solved | 15 Agents |
User review
“We adopted Freshdesk because it is a highly adaptable solution with metrics that allow us to track and follow up on our customers and agents efficiently.” Christophe Tomborski Back Office Manager, Bridgestone |
Speed up your customer support by 83% with Freshdesk’s ticketing solution
Investing in a reliable ticketing solution can help businesses deliver exceptional customer service, boosting retention and building deeper trust, even when handling high ticket volumes without overburdening support staff. Looking for a solution that can help you achieve these goals effortlessly? Switch to Freshdesk.
Trusted by over 73,000+ businesses worldwide, Freshdesk is a leading customer service software with advanced AI-powered ticketing capabilities. Powered by Freddy AI, its proprietary AI engine, Freshdesk enables intelligent automation that streamlines support processes such as ticket triaging and routing, boosting operational efficiency, and reducing manual efforts.
With AI agents and AI-driven automation, Freshdesk helps businesses respond up to 83% faster. Its Freddy AI Copilot further enhances agent productivity by 60%, offering features like writing assistance, thread summarization, and response suggestions. Most importantly, with a 97% omnichannel first-contact resolution rate, Freshdesk ensures consistent, high-quality support across all channels.
Want to deliver exceptional customer support and boost customer loyalty? Book a personalized demo today.
Frequently asked questions
What types of businesses require a ticketing system?
Any business that provides customer service, i.e., receiving and responding to customer inquiries, can benefit from a ticketing system, whether it’s an established enterprise or an emerging startup. For small and medium-sized businesses, it ensures that every ticket is addressed promptly across all channels, helping them build a loyal customer base as they grow.
For large enterprises, ticketing systems make it easier to manage high ticket volumes across multiple channels without overwhelming staff. Common industries that rely heavily on ticketing systems include eCommerce, financial services, healthcare, SaaS, and education.
How does a ticketing system improve customer experience?
A ticketing system ensures that no customer inquiry goes unanswered and that every customer receives the right attention, making them feel valued. It also provides agents with the context they need quickly to provide fast, accurate, and helpful resolutions, enhancing customer satisfaction without increasing average handle time.
Additionally, advanced self-service capabilities empower customers to resolve their queries independently without contacting support. Together, these features simplify the customer experience, deepen trust, and boost retention.
Can ticketing systems integrate with other business tools?
Yes. Most ticketing systems seamlessly integrate with third-party business applications, such as CRM software, eCommerce platforms, billing systems, project management tools, and more. This enables agents to access deeper customer insights and provide detailed and accurate resolutions more quickly.
Can a ticketing system be tailored to specific business needs?
Yes. Ticketing systems like Freshdesk can be easily customized to fit your unique business needs. You can:
Customize the customer portal according to your brand’s voice, look, and feel.
Build unique workflows to automate key operations
Create custom fields to capture the important details you require
Generate customizable reports to track metrics that matter most to your business.
How to choose the right ticketing software for our business?
Start by analyzing your business requirements, such as the channels your customers prefer most, average ticket volume, budget, and team size. Then, identify the features you need, such as omnichannel support, AI-driven automation, workflow builders, AI agents, and Copilots. Next, shortlist a few ticketing solutions with strong reviews, reputation, and features that match your budget.
Evaluate ease of use, scalability (ability to handle growing ticket volumes without performance issues), and the quality of training/onboarding support provided by the vendor. Finally, choose the solution that offers the right balance of features, brand trust, and cost-effectiveness for your business.
Related resources
10 best free ticketing software of 2025
Explore the top 10 free ticketing software of 2025 and compare features, pricing, pros, and cons to choose the right tool for your business.
Top 15 Email Ticketing Systems of 2025
Explore the best email ticketing systems for 2025 and find smart solutions to improve your customer support.
Cloud-Based Ticketing System Guide for Helpdesks
Discover the advantages of a cloud-based ticketing system. Learn key benefits, best practices, and see how Freshdesk compares today.
AI Ticketing System: Features and 5 Best Software
Boost customer support efficiency with AI ticketing. Explore benefits, features, and the top 5 systems for faster responses and happier customers.